I am always with you,
You cannot live without me.
Those first tentative cries
When you leave your mother’s womb,
Signal that I am there.
Throughout your life
I come in various guises,
Within the soft gentleness of sleep,
The gasps of wonder at the beauty in the world,
The rapidness during exertion and exhaustion.
There then comes the time
When your end in this world arrives,
And at your last breath,
You finally exhale me for the final time,
As I am the air that you breathe.
